📜 Detailed Financial Report
The Circle, released in 2017, entered the cinematic marketplace with the goal of capturing global audiences. Production insiders estimate the budget to be around $18,000,000. This figure typically includes principal photography, talent fees, and post-production costs, but often excludes marketing and distribution expenses which can add another 30-50% to the total investment.
